Description of The North Face Freedom Pant - Women's:
Sick of tight, retro-style ski pants? Grab The North Face Women's Freedom Pants. A relaxed, contemporary fit gives you room to move, and the waterproof breathable fabric keeps your legs dry throughout winter storms. Mesh panels in the gaiters work with thigh vents to create full-leg air circulation, so you won't end up with sweat-soaked legs on warm spring ski days. Layer long johns under The North Face Freedom Pants during chilly mid-winter weather. Fully taped seams block moisture, and a cargo pocket on the Freedom shell pants gives you a place to stash your trail map.

Bottom Line: Liberate your legs from tight, uncomfortable ski pants.

Comfortable and great fit for short women   12-19-08
Raivyn (4): rank
Like the previous poster, I am 5'2" and 150 lbs. These pants fit me perfectly. They are fitted at the waist but do not pinch when you bend down or sit. They have a very tailored look, and the waist is adjustable very easily. The quality of construction is top notch. The short length fits me; the regular length was too long. Typically when I buy pants that have articulated knees, the knees actually fall in the middle of my shin, so my knees are still very restricted when I bend them. With the shorter length, the knees actually fall to where my knees are, so when I bend them there is no restriction at all. Even though these are considered a shell, they would be perfectly warm enough on a mildly cold day. They definitely aren't as warm as the insulated version, but they are not a strict shell (i.e. like your shell rain jacket would be). The side vents are easy to access if you become too warm while on the mt. on those bright sunny days. I highly recommend these pants. They are extremely comfortable and fit great.

Very Nice!!   11-30-08
Jan Higa (9): rank
Yes, they do run big and thank you North face for gearing your clothing to all women of all shapes and sizes. Large is actually large. Most outdoor companies design clothing for tall slim women. I'm 5'2 and 150. Usually I have to have some sort of alteration done. the Large/short pants fit great and will go bigger in the waist with a simple adjustment. They even make xlarge pants that were way to big for me. I snowboard and like my clothing fairly loose. I also like the fact that the cargo pocket is actually big enough for me to put my hand in. Again, most pockets in womens ski and snowboard clothing are not functional and if it is, you pay a premium. I want functional clothing when I'm out on the slopes, not fashion. Great product!

Material: [Shell] HyVent 2L; [Lining] Thermoliner I
Insulation: None
Waterproof Rating: Not specified
Breathable Rating: Not specified
Side Zips: No
Venting: Chimney Venting (mesh in gaiters & thigh vents)
Pockets: 2 Front, 1 cargo
Seam Taped: Yes, fully
Waist: Adjustable hook-and-loop tabs, belt loops
Gaiters: Yes
Recommended Use: Skiing, snowboarding
Manufacturer Warranty: Lifetime
